What is a 6-Foot Container?
A 6-foot container, likewise known as a 6-foot storage unit or shipping container, is usually a portable storage option that measures 6 feet in length. It is smaller than the standard shipping containers that are often 20 or 40 feet long, making it an ideal choice for those who need a more manageable storage choice. These containers can be made from different products, consisting of steel and aluminum, and are often designed to hold up against severe ecological conditions.
Size Specifications
| Container Type | Length | Width | Height | Volume (Approx.) |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 6-Foot Container | 6 ft | 4 ft | 4 ft | 96 cubic feet |
Applications of a 6-Foot Container
The flexibility of a 6-foot container makes it appropriate for a variety of applications. Here are some typical usages:
- Personal Storage: Ideal for saving seasonal products, sports equipment, and garden tools, permitting house owners to clean up space in their garages or sheds.
- Company Inventory: Small merchants or e-commerce organizations can utilize these containers as a cost-effective solution for excess stock, tools, or equipment.
- Building Sites: At building and construction websites, they serve as on-site storage for tools, materials, and products, safeguarding them from weather and theft.
- Mobile Office: With some modification, a 6-foot container can be transformed into a mobile office for job sites or temporary setups.
- Emergency Storage: Useful during emergency situations or natural catastrophes, they can be utilized to securely keep vital products and equipment till the crisis passes.
- Art and Antique Storage: Museums or collectors can securely keep important products that need climate control in a safe and secure environment.

Purchasing Considerations
When looking to purchase a 6-foot container, numerous factors ought to be thought about:
- Condition: Containers can be new or utilized. Utilized containers are typically significantly less expensive but might reveal signs of wear and tear.
- Gain access to: Ensure that you have adequate space for the shipment and placement of the container.
- Place: Consider if you'll need to move the container regularly, as this might affect your purchasing choice.
- Weight Capacity: Understand the weight limits of the container, especially if you plan to store heavy products.
- Personalizations: Look for providers who provide modifications, like shelving or insulation, customized to your needs.
Often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. Just how much does a 6-foot container cost?The price of a 6-foot container can differ commonly depending upon its condition, adjustments, and geographical location. Typically, you may discover prices varying from ₤ 1,500 to ₤ 5,000.
2. Can I keep a container on my property?Yes, you can keep a container on your home, however check regional zoning laws and regulations to make sure compliance, specifically in suburbs.
3. Are containers weatherproof?Yes, the majority of shipping containers are developed to be weatherproof and can endure a variety of ecological conditions. However, appropriate sealing might be necessary to improve their sturdiness.
4. What kinds of modifications can be made?Adjustments can consist of windows, doors, insulation, ventilation, and shelving, turning a simple container into a practical area for different uses.
5. How do I transport a container?Transporting a container generally needs a flatbed truck or a specialized container shipment service. Ensure that you hire specialists who comprehend the logistics included.
